How Roof Covering Ventilation Works
Effective roof covering ventilation counts on the all-natural motion of air to produce an equilibrium between consumption and exhaust. When you install vents, you're essentially allowing fresh air to enter your attic room while allowing warm, stagnant air to leave. This process assists regulate temperature and moisture levels, stopping concerns like mold development and roof damage.
Consumption vents, generally discovered at the eaves, reel in cool air from outside. On the other hand, exhaust vents, situated near the ridge of the roof, allow hot air rise and departure. The distinction in temperature produces an all-natural air flow, known as the stack impact. As cozy air increases, it creates a vacuum that draws in cooler air from the reduced vents.
To maximize this system, you need to guarantee that the consumption and exhaust vents are appropriately sized and placed. If the consumption is restricted, you will not attain the desired ventilation.
Furthermore, insufficient exhaust can catch heat and dampness, leading to prospective damage.
